Bioinformatics Solutions Inc. Announces P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5

Today, Bioinformatics Solutions Inc. (BSI) is excited to announce the release of P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5, the latest innovation in glycoproteomics and glycomics data analysis. With enhanced glycan profiling capabilities and new quantification workflows, P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5 empowers researchers to explore glycan heterogeneity with greater accuracy and confidence.

What’s New in P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5?
- Integrated Glycoproteomics and Glycomics Solutions – Characterize and quantify both intact glycopeptides and released glycans within a unified workflow.
- Expanded Glycan Profiling for N-linked and O-linked Glycans – Enhanced structural confidence in glycan characterization.
- Accurate and Flexible Quantification – Support for label-free and reporter ion-based glycopeptide quantification, including a new PRM quantification workflow.
What’s Enhanced?
- Comprehensive Glycosylation Site Profiling – Utilize multiple enzyme digests for a broader and more detailed panorama of glycosylation sites.
- Glycan de novo Sequencing – Discover novel glycans that may not be present in existing databases.
- Vendor-Neutral Data Compatibility – Analyze data from Orbitrap, timsTOF, and ZenoTOF instruments seamlessly.
- Enhanced Visualization and Reporting – Improved GUI for streamlined validation and data exploration.
Bridging Glycomics and Glycoproteomics
With Released Glycan Sample Profiling, P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5 enables in-depth characterization of released glycans. The software now supports customized glycan modifications, adduct searches, and cross-ring annotation, providing more detailed glycan spectrum interpretation. Additionally, Released Glycan Reporter Ion Quantification (RIQ) enhances sensitivity and reproducibility, ensuring confident glycan abundance measurements across samples.
Unprecedented Quantification Capabilities
Quantification remains a cornerstone of glycoproteomics, and P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5 introduces key advancements:
- Label-Free Quantification (LFQ) – Reliable feature alignment across multiple samples for confident abundance measurements.
- Reporter Ion Quantification (RIQ) – Support for user-defined and commercial labels such as iTRAQ and TMT.
- New PRM Quantification Workflow – Targeted glycopeptide quantification with MS2 structural annotation.
Decipher Glycan Associations using Glycan Network
P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5 introduces an intuitive Glycan Network, illustrating relationships between glycan compositions. By visualizing how glycans differ by a single monosaccharide, researchers can uncover functional and biological glycan associations more effectively.
Resolve Glycan Ambiguity with Structural Resolution (S-Score)
To enhance glycan structure confidence, PEAKS GlycanFinder 2.5 provides an S-Score (%). This ensures higher accuracy in glycopeptide identification.
